Connecting via AUX Port
1. Connect an external device to the DSF11’s [AUX Port]
using an AUX cable.
2. Select the [AUX] menu item from the Home screen and
set to [ON].
3. Music from the external device can now be output
through the DSF11’s speakers.
Connecting via Optical In
1. Connect an external device to the DSF11’s [OPT IN] using
an optical cable.
2. Select the [Optical] menu item from the Home screen and
set to [ON].
3. Music from the external device can now be output
through the DSF11’s speakers.
